如何在VCS MX/VCS MXi中设置仿真参数以进行高效芯片验证?请提供配置示例。
时间: 2024-11-20 07:45:55 浏览: 40
为了在VCS MX/VCS MXi中进行高效芯片验证,正确设置仿真参数是非常关键的一步。你可以参考这份资料《VCS® MX/VCS MXi™ 2014用户指南:芯片验证工具》来深入了解如何配置仿真参数。在这份指南中,你将会找到关于如何使用命令行选项、环境变量和配置文件来调整VCS MX/VCS MXi的仿真行为的详细说明。例如,你可以使用+acc参数来开启指令级的加速功能,从而提升仿真速度。除此之外,合理配置内存使用、多核并行处理参数以及调试选项也对于提高验证效率至关重要。建议先阅读用户指南中关于仿真参数设置的章节,然后在实际操作中进行尝试,找到最佳配置以满足你的验证需求。完成验证工作后,为了进一步提升你的知识和技能,可以继续深入学习《VCS® MX/VCS MXi™ 2014用户指南:芯片验证工具》中的高级功能,例如使用内置的覆盖率分析工具以及如何编写有效的断言来捕捉和定位设计错误。通过这份全面的文档,你可以更全面地掌握VCS MX/VCS MXi的使用,进一步提高芯片验证的效率和效果。
参考资源链接:[VCS® MX/VCS MXi™ 2014用户指南:芯片验证工具](https://wenku.csdn.net/doc/5bcapxsik0?spm=1055.2569.3001.10343)
相关问题
在进行芯片验证时,如何利用VCS MX/VCS MXi设置高效的仿真参数?请结合《VCS® MX/VCS MXi™ 2014用户指南:芯片验证工具》给出具体的操作步骤和配置示例。
为了实现高效的芯片验证,正确设置VCS MX/VCS MXi的仿真参数至关重要。《VCS® MX/VCS MXi™ 2014用户指南:芯片验证工具》提供了详尽的指导和参考,是掌握这一技能不可或缺的资源。根据指南,以下是设置仿真参数的步骤和示例:
参考资源链接:[VCS® MX/VCS MXi™ 2014用户指南:芯片验证工具](https://wenku.csdn.net/doc/5bcapxsik0?spm=1055.2569.3001.10343)
1. 打开命令行界面,运行vcs命令启动仿真环境。
2. 使用-assert选项来设置断言检查级别。例如,若要开启所有断言检查,可以在命令行中输入-assert all。
3. 使用-f选项来指定仿真使用的文件。例如,若要加载名为testbench.v的设计和测试台文件,可以使用-f testbench.v。
4. 使用-l选项来指定日志文件。例如,-l simv.log将仿真过程中的日志信息输出到simv.log文件中。
5. 使用-pn选项来指定仿真进程的名称。例如,使用-pn my_simulation可以将仿真进程命名为my_simulation。
示例配置:
```bash
vcs -full64 -debug_all -assert all -f design.v -f testbench.v -l simv.log -pn my_simulation
```
在这个示例中,我们使用了多种参数来优化仿真过程:
- -full64确保仿真器以64位模式运行。
- -debug_all允许所有的调试功能。
- -assert all启用了所有断言的检查,帮助捕捉设计中的问题。
- -f选项后跟两个文件,设计和测试台文件都被加载。
- -l选项指定了日志文件,方便后续分析。
- -pn选项设置了仿真进程的名称。
通过这样的配置,可以确保仿真过程高效且具有针对性。更多细节和高级配置,可以参考《VCS® MX/VCS MXi™ 2014用户指南:芯片验证工具》中的“仿真参数配置”章节。
在完成当前问题的解决后,建议进一步深入学习VCS MX/VCS MXi提供的高级验证技术、覆盖率分析和调试功能,以全面掌握芯片验证的高级技巧。《VCS® MX/VCS MXi™ 2014用户指南:芯片验证工具》将是你继续深入学习的宝贵资源。
参考资源链接:[VCS® MX/VCS MXi™ 2014用户指南:芯片验证工具](https://wenku.csdn.net/doc/5bcapxsik0?spm=1055.2569.3001.10343)
vcs mx/vcs mxi user guide 2017
### 回答1:
vcs mx和vcs mxi是一种虚拟仿真工具,主要用于硬件设计的验证和调试。它们是由某公司开发的,提供了一套丰富的功能和工具,以帮助工程师们更有效地完成设计任务。
《vcs mx/vcs mxi用户指南2017》是针对这两款工具的用户手册,主要介绍了它们的安装与配置、基本操作、高级功能、应用案例等方面的内容。
首先,用户指南将向读者介绍如何正确安装和配置vcs mx/vcs mxi工具,并提供了详细的步骤和注意事项。它还会介绍工具所需的系统配置和硬件要求,以及与其他设计工具的兼容性等信息。
接下来,用户指南将重点介绍vcs mx/vcs mxi的基本操作。这包括创建和设置设计项目、导入和编辑设计文件、设置仿真环境和参数等。它会提供丰富的示例和截图,帮助读者更好地理解和掌握这些操作。
此外,用户指南还介绍了vcs mx/vcs mxi的一些高级功能,例如调试工具、时序分析、波形查看器等。这些功能可以帮助工程师们更深入地分析和验证设计,提高工作效率。
最后,用户指南会提供一些应用案例,展示vcs mx/vcs mxi在不同领域的应用实践。这些案例涵盖了芯片设计、通信系统、存储设备等多个领域,读者可以从中学习到实际的应用技巧和经验。
总之,《vcs mx/vcs mxi用户指南2017》是一本全面介绍vcs mx/vcs mxi工具的手册,对于想要学习和使用这款工具的工程师们来说,是一份非常有价值的参考资料。
### 回答2:
"vcs mx/vcs mxi 用户指南 2017" 是一本指导用户如何使用vcs mx和vcs mxi软件的手册,这些软件可能是某种虚拟计算机系统或者开发工具。这本指南为用户提供了关于软件功能、操作方法和最佳实践的详细说明和指导。
该用户指南的目的是帮助用户快速了解vcs mx和vcs mxi软件,并掌握如何使用这些软件进行开发、测试或者管理任务。用户指南可能包括以下内容:
1. 软件介绍:指南可能开始介绍vcs mx和vcs mxi软件的功能和特点,以及其在计算机系统开发和管理中的应用领域。
2. 系统要求:用户可能会找到有关软件运行所需的硬件配置和操作系统要求的信息。这些信息有助于用户确保他们的计算机系统能够满足软件的运行要求。
3. 安装和设置:用户可能会找到有关如何正确安装和设置vcs mx和vcs mxi软件的步骤和指导。这些步骤可能包括创建用户账户、配置软件参数和连接到其他系统或网络。
4. 功能和操作:用户指南可能会详细介绍vcs mx和vcs mxi软件的各种功能和操作方法。这可能包括创建和管理虚拟计算机、设置网络连接、安装和运行应用程序等。
5. 故障排除和常见问题:用户指南可能会列出可能遇到的常见问题和故障排除方法,以帮助用户解决使用软件时可能出现的问题。
请注意,以上内容只是一个关于"vcs mx/vcs mxi 用户指南 2017"的假设回答。实际的用户指南的具体内容将根据软件的特点和发布者的选择而有所不同。
阅读全文